
In the world of data storytelling, a Gradient Chart stands out as a powerful device for conveying layered information at a glance. By mapping numerical values to colour, a Gradient Chart transforms complex datasets into instantly legible patterns. This comprehensive guide will walk you through the theory, the practical steps, and the pitfalls to avoid when creating Gradient Chart visualisations. Whether you are a data scientist, a designer, or a business analyst, mastering gradient charts can elevate your reports, dashboards and publications.
What is a Gradient Chart?
A Gradient Chart, often simply called a gradient plot or gradient visualisation, is a chart that uses a colour ramp to represent a range of values. Instead of relying solely on position or size to communicate information, a gradient chart assigns a colour to each data point based on its value. The result is a map where darker, lighter, or differently hued areas indicate higher or lower quantities, intensities or frequencies.
There are several flavours of gradient visualisation, and they share a common principle: colour, when chosen with care, behaves as a perceptual cue that our brains can read quickly. However, not all colour scales are created equal. A well-constructed Gradient Chart uses a perceptually uniform palette, where equal steps in data produce roughly equal perceptual steps in colour. Poor palettes can mislead the viewer, exaggerating or diminishing trends, hiding gaps, or trapping the eye in artefacts.
Why Gradient Chart Mathematics and Perception Matter
To build a Gradient Chart that communicates accurately, you need to bridge two domains: data mathematics and human colour perception. On the mathematical side, you must select a quantitative scale that suits the data type—sequential scales for ordered data, diverging scales for values around a critical midpoint, or multiple hues for categorical gradients. On the perceptual side, you must pick a palette that the eye can interpret easily, is accessible to colour-blind viewers, and maintains legibility when printed or displayed on screens of varying quality.
In practice, a Gradient Chart supports a reader’s cognitive workflow. It allows you to identify hotspots, gradient transitions, and anomalies in seconds, without reading every cell or annotation. The design decision behind a gradient chart should align with the story you want to tell. If you aim to highlight rising risk, you might employ a cool-to-warm palette that moves from cool blues to hot oranges. If you want to compare symmetrical deviations from a mean, a diverging gradient centred on a neutral colour can be more intuitive.
Choosing the Right Gradient Palette
Colour Theory and Perception
Colour choice is not merely decorative. The palette defines how data is perceived. Perceptual uniformity means that equal steps in data are perceived as equal steps in colour. This is essential for gradients that represent continuous data. Some palettes are designed specifically for this purpose, such as Viridis and other perceptually uniform colormaps. When selecting a Gradient Chart palette, consider hue, saturation, and lightness balance. A palette with too many distinct hues can distract; a single hue family with varying lightness often works well for linear data, while adding a second diverging colour helps with centred data.
Palette Options: From Viridis to Diverging Schemes
Popular gradient palettes include:
- Viridis: A perceptually uniform, colour-blind friendly sequential palette that moves from purple to blue to green.
- Plasma: A bright, perceptually uniform palette with a hot-to-cool progression.
- Cividis: Designed for colour-vision deficiencies, maintaining good perceptual uniformity.
- Inferno and Magma: High-contrast sequential palettes with strong tonal variation.
- Diverging palettes: Useful when data has a critical midpoint, such as deviations above and below a benchmark.
- Custom palettes: For brand alignment or specific storytelling needs, a carefully crafted gradient can be created, but should still respect perceptual order.
When you design a Gradient Chart, you might balance aesthetics with legibility. For screens, consider a medium brightness range to avoid clipping in bright displays. For print, test your gradient on a grayscale reproduction to ensure it maintains readability even without colour.
Crafting a Gradient Chart Across Tools
Different tools offer different capabilities for Gradient Chart creation. The underlying principles remain the same, but the interfaces and options vary. Here are practical approaches across common platforms.
Spreadsheet Solutions: Excel and Google Sheets
Spreadsheets are often the first port of call for quick gradient charts. They provide straightforward options to bind a data scale to a gradient fill. In both Excel and Google Sheets, you can apply conditional formatting or gradient rules to a range of cells that represent values, producing a heat-map-like gradient that can be interpreted as a Gradient Chart. For sequential data, select a colour ramp appropriate to your data type, such as blue-to-red or green-to-purple. For diverging data, choose a palette that centres on a neutral colour at the midpoint.
Tips for spreadsheet Gradient Charting:
- Define a clear minimum and maximum in your data; ensure the gradient respects these bounds.
- Use data bars or colour scales that are easily legible in both digital and print formats.
- Keep the gradient direction consistent across related charts to avoid misinterpretation.
- Document the colour scale in a legend or caption so readers understand the data-to-colour mapping.
Programming Approaches: Python and R
For rigorous analysis and repeatable visualisations, programming offers fine-grained control over a Gradient Chart. Python’s Matplotlib or Seaborn, and R’s ggplot2, enable precise specification of colour maps, value ranges and legends. When implementing, choose a proper colormap, set normalization to reflect the data distribution, and annotate critical thresholds to reinforce interpretation.
Python examples conceptually involve:
- Loading data and normalising values to a 0-1 scale.
- Applying a perceptually uniform colour map to a 2D matrix or a line with fill.
- Including a colour bar with explicit tick marks that map to data values.
In R, you may use scale_fill_gradientn or scale_color_gradientn with a curated palette, ensuring the breakpoints align with the data’s meaningful thresholds. The goal is a Gradient Chart that remains legible when the viewer scans the surface for hotspots or trends.
BI Tools: Power BI, Tableau
Business intelligence tools offer interactive Gradient Chart capabilities with built-in colour ramps and accessible defaults. In Tableau, you can drag a continuous field onto Colour, select a colour palette, and adjust the start and end points to suit your data distribution. Power BI provides gradient formatting options in conditional formatting to apply to cells, tables, or heatmaps. In both cases, the Gradient Chart should support hover details, tooltips and filters so the user can explore the data without losing context.
Accessibility and Inclusivity in Gradient Chart Design
Accessible design is not an afterthought; it is a design discipline. A Gradient Chart that is readable by a broad audience—including people with colour vision deficiencies—improves comprehension and reduces the risk of misinterpretation. Practical steps include:
- Choosing perceptually uniform palettes that maintain order even when viewed in grayscale or by readers with colour vision deficiencies.
- Providing a clear legend with numeric values or tick marks that map colour to data values.
- Adding labels and brief explanations in the chart caption to guide interpretation.
- Testing the Gradient Chart in different lighting environments and on mobile devices where contrast can vary.
When possible, include additional channels of information, such as annotations or contours, to support readers who may struggle with colour alone. A well-constructed Gradient Chart communicates through colour, but it also communicates through structure, labels, and context.
Best Practices and Common Mistakes
Best Practices
- Use perceptually uniform colour maps for quantitative data to preserve true data relationships.
- Centre diverging palettes around a meaningful midpoint (e.g., zero or the mean) to emphasize deviations.
- Provide an explicit colour bar with tick marks and numeric labels for reproducibility and clarity.
- Keep the gradient range consistent across related visuals for comparability.
- Avoid overly saturated colours that can cause eye strain in long reading sessions.
- Consider colour-blind friendly palettes as a default standard.
- Offer alternative textual or numeric summaries of the gradient when possible.
Common Mistakes
- Using a gradient palette that is not perceptually uniform, causing misinterpretation of the data scale.
- Overloading a single Gradient Chart with too many categories or hues, which blurs distinctions.
- Neglecting to label the scale or to provide context about what the colours represent.
- Relying solely on colour to convey critical information; add shapes, sizes or annotations for emphasis.
- Inconsistent gradient orientation between charts in the same report, which confuses readers.
Advanced Techniques: Gradient Chart Direction, Data Ordering and Annotations
As you gain experience with Gradient Charting, you may experiment with directionality, data ordering, and informative annotations to reveal insights more effectively.
Direction and Orientation
The direction of a gradient can influence how readers perceive trends. A left-to-right or bottom-to-top gradient often aligns with natural reading patterns. In time-series data, a top-to-bottom gradient may convey progression, while a circular gradient can illustrate cyclical phenomena. The key is to be deliberate about direction to support the narrative rather than confuse it.
Ordering and Binning
How you order data can dramatically affect the gradient’s legibility. Consider arranging data to highlight meaningful progressions, such as grouping by season, region or category, before applying the colour ramp. When data are highly skewed, binning into discrete ranges can help, while still presenting a gradient feel within each bin. Binning should be disclosed, and the boundaries chosen to reflect domain-relevant thresholds.
Annotations and Context
Annotating Gradient Charts with callouts, reference lines, or shaded bands can dramatically improve comprehension. For example, indicating regulatory thresholds, target levels, or historical baselines alongside the gradient helps the reader anchor their interpretation. Ensure annotations don’t obscure the gradient or overwhelm the data with too much text.
Gradient Chart in Dashboards and Reports
Gradient Chart visuals are particularly effective in dashboards where rapid interpretation is essential. In executive dashboards, a single well-designed Gradient Chart can convey risk levels, performance deltas or resource utilisation at a glance. In annual or quarterly reports, a gradient-based heatmap can illustrate distributional changes across regions or products. When integrating Gradient Chart visuals into dashboards, consider responsive layouts, tooltip richness, and cross-filter interactions so readers can drill down without losing the gradient’s overall story.
Case Studies: Gradient Chart In Action
Real-world examples demonstrate how Gradient Charting translates data into insight. A city’s heat map of air quality, mapped with a perceptual gradient, can reveal pollution hotspots and times of day with elevated exposure. A retailer’s sales performance across stores can be displayed as a gradient chart by region to spotlight high-growth areas and those needing attention. In science, gradient charts are used to display temperature gradients in materials, geological surveys, or climate model outputs, where smooth colour transitions communicate gradual change with precision.
Interpreting and Explaining Gradient Chart Outputs
Interpreting a Gradient Chart involves a mix of pattern recognition and contextual knowledge. Look for gradient bands that align with known thresholds or events. Spot sudden shifts that deviate from the overall gradient, which may indicate anomalies or data quality issues. A well-documented Gradient Chart includes a legend that maps colours to values, a description of the data source, the date range, and any transformations applied during data preparation. When presenting to stakeholders, accompany the gradient with a concise narrative that explains what the colours signify and what decisions they should drive.
Future Trends in Gradient Charting
As data grows in volume and complexity, Gradient Charting continues to evolve. Expect improvements in accessibility features, such as adaptive palettes that adjust to viewer preferences and screen capabilities. Interactive gradient maps that allow real-time filtering, brushing, and annotation will become more prevalent in enterprise analytics tools. On the design front, the best Gradient Chart practitioners will blend aesthetics with clarity, ensuring that every colour choice adds interpretive value rather than decorative flourish.
Practical Checklist: How to Build a Gradient Chart from Scratch
Before you start, run through this practical checklist to ensure your Gradient Chart is effective and publication-ready.
- Define the data type and choose a suitable gradient approach (sequential, diverging, or qualitative).
- Choose a perceptually uniform colour map suitable for the data and audience.
- Set the gradient range with meaningful minimum and maximum values and, if relevant, a midpoint.
- Provide a clear legend with numeric labels and units where applicable.
- Consider accessibility: test in grayscale and ensure colour-blind friendly choices.
- Annotate key thresholds, targets, or notable observations to guide interpretation.
- Validate the gradient’s consistency across related visuals in the same report or dashboard.
- Document data sources, transformations and the rationale for the chosen palette.
Capturing the Narrative: Gradient Chart in Storytelling
A Gradient Chart is more than a pretty visual. It’s a narrative device that communicates a story about the data, the relationship between variables, and the intensity of phenomena across space, time or categories. When coupled with well-chosen annotations and a succinct caption, a Gradient Chart can replace lengthy prose with a single, compelling image. The most effective gradient stories answer three questions: what changed, where did it change the most, and what does this mean for decision-making?
Common Formats Where Gradient Chart Shines
Gradient charts are particularly suited to certain kinds of data presentations. Consider the following formats where Gradient Chart excels:
- Temporal progression: heatmaps or line-with-area fills illustrating how a metric evolves over days, months or years.
- Geographical distribution: regional gradients showing measurement intensity by location.
- Process monitoring: flow or stage-wise charts that encode concentration or yield via colour intensity.
- Quality control: mapping defect density or tolerance levels across products or production lines.
Glossary: Key Terms Explored
To aid comprehension, here are concise explanations of terms you are likely to encounter when working with Gradient Chart visualisations:
- Gradient Chart: a chart that uses colour scales to represent quantitative values across a data field.
- Colormap: a palette of colours used to map data values to colours in a visualisation.
- Perceptual Uniformity: a property of a colour map where equal steps in data produce roughly equal perceptual changes in colour.
- Diverging Palette: a colour ramp that uses two contrasts meeting at a neutral midpoint, ideal for deviations from a baseline.
- Legends: the explanatory captions or scales that connect colours to data values.
- Accessibility: design practices that ensure visuals are readable by a broad audience, including those with colour vision deficiencies.
Conclusion: Your Path to Mastery with Gradient Chart
Gradient Chart visualisation is a versatile tool in the data communicator’s toolkit. By marrying thoughtful colour science with robust data logic, you can craft visuals that reveal patterns, highlight trends, and prompt informed action. The key is to start with a clear narrative, choose a perceptually faithful palette, and provide readers with the context they need to interpret colour meaningfully. Practice with real datasets, test across devices and print, and always prioritise accessibility and clarity. With these principles, Gradient Chart visualisations will not only look striking but will also communicate with precision and impact.